Jeffrey Leaf

Info

Role

Director | Actor | Writer

Date of birth

08/02/1979

Place of birth

Great Falls, Montana, USA

Jeffrey Leaf

Known For

1923

1923

8.4
8.4
The Blacklist

The Blacklist

8.0
8.0
FBI

FBI

7.2
7.2
Bad Country

Bad Country

5.8
5.8